    Understanding ILA Paz School's Tuition Structure

    Tuition at ILA Paz School is structured to support the school's commitment to providing a high-quality, comprehensive education. The tuition fees are determined by several factors, including the grade level of the student and the programs they are enrolled in. Generally, tuition fees increase as students advance through the grades, reflecting the more advanced curriculum and resources required for older students. In the early years, such as preschool and elementary school, the tuition fees are typically lower compared to middle and high school. This difference accounts for the varying levels of resources, specialized instruction, and advanced facilities needed as students progress in their academic journey.

    ILA Paz School may also offer different tuition rates based on residency status. For instance, local students who are residents of Costa Rica might have a different fee structure compared to international students. This is a common practice in many international schools, as the costs associated with supporting international students can be higher due to additional services such as visa assistance, language support, and cultural integration programs. Understanding these nuances is essential to accurately budget for your child's education at ILA Paz School.

    It's important to note that tuition fees often cover a wide range of educational expenses, including classroom instruction, access to school facilities such as libraries and science labs, and standard learning materials. However, there may be additional fees for specific programs or activities, such as field trips, extracurricular activities, or specialized courses. These additional costs can vary depending on the student's interests and involvement in school activities. For example, students participating in sports teams or clubs might need to pay additional fees to cover equipment, uniforms, and travel expenses. Similarly, specialized courses like advanced placement (AP) classes or international baccalaureate (IB) programs may require additional fees for course materials and examination costs.

    Payment Plans and Financial Aid Options

    Okay, let's talk about making tuition more manageable. Paying for education is a big deal, and ILA Paz School, like many schools, usually offers different ways to help families out. First off, payment plans can be a lifesaver. Instead of having to pay the whole tuition upfront, you can often spread the payments out over several months. This can make things way easier on your monthly budget. Schools might have different payment schedules, so it's worth checking out what options they have and picking one that works best for you.

    Financial aid is another awesome option to explore. Many schools offer scholarships or grants to students who need a little extra help covering tuition costs. These awards can be based on things like academic achievement, financial need, or even specific talents. To apply for financial aid, you'll usually need to fill out an application and provide some financial info, like your income and expenses. The school will then review your application and decide if you qualify for assistance. It's definitely worth applying, even if you're not sure you'll get anything – you never know!

    Some schools also offer discounts for things like paying tuition early or having multiple kids enrolled. If you can swing it, paying early might save you some money. And if you have more than one child attending the school, be sure to ask about sibling discounts. Every little bit helps, right?
